Wetzlar, Germany — Leica Microsystems, a leader in microscopy and scientific instrumentation and advanced imaging solutions, announced today that it has acquired ATTO-TEC, a leading specialty supplier of fluorescent dyes and reagents. The addition of dyes and reagents for sample preparation complements the renowned Leica portfolio of microscopy imaging platforms and advanced AI-based analysis software. […]

DKSH has received Global ISO certifications for environmental practices (ISO 14001) as well as occupational health and safety (ISO 45001) across multiple markets. This achievement reinforces DKSH’s commitment to sustainability and safety in its supply chains, which are continuously improved. Nikon and eLabNext partner to enhance data integration between NIS-Elements imaging software and eLabNext’s Digital Lab Platform. The NIS-Elements eLabNext module allows users to seamlessly exchange experimental details between NIS-Elements and eLabNext’s Digital Lab Platform with high efficiency and minimal effort.
